There … WebBeaufort Wind Scale One of the first scales to estimate wind speeds and the effects was created by Britain's Admiral Sir Francis Beaufort (1774-1857). He developed the scale in 1805 to help sailors estimate the winds via visual observations. The scale starts with 0 and goes to a force of 12.

WebNov 22, 2011 · The wind speed is mostly measured using an anemometer, and the basic unit for the measurement of the wind speed is “knot”. 1 knot is equal to 0.5144 meters per second or 1.852 kilometers per hour. Units such as miles per hour and kilometers per hour are also used in measuring the wind speed.

WebA combination of long/short barbs and pennants indicate the speed of the wind in station weather plots rounded to the nearest 5 knots. Calm wind is indicated by a large circle drawn around the skycover symbol. One long barb is used to indicate each 10 knots with the short barb representing 5 knots. At 50 knots, the barbs changes to a pennant.
